“Why will there be a great northern migration due to climate change?”
For the vast majority of human history, the more habitable region of the Earth for humans was closer to the equator, where year-round good weather made it easy to live, work, and produce harvest. However, with the advent of climate change, this part of the globe is becoming hotter and hotter to the point where it might become less habitable. This will spring migration northward, reshaping planetary demographics as we know it. If handled with equity and care, this Northern Migration Due to Climate Change can lead to millions of new residents being integrated into and benefiting their host nation.
